
Android
文章平均质量分 73
Flame_Dream
创出一片属于自己的天地……
展开
-
Android 反编译Apk (Mac)
主要是介绍Mac下反编译Apk原创 2022-08-01 16:39:08 · 2204 阅读 · 0 评论 -
Android compileSdkVersion、minSdkVersion、targetSdkVersion的区别
Android总结compileSdkVersion、minSdkVersion、targetSdkVersion详细细节原创 2022-05-17 20:04:38 · 7124 阅读 · 0 评论 -
Android调试adb不可以错过的常用方法!!!
前言 工欲善其事,必先利其器。 Android开发也是一样,需要先了解开发使用的工具adb。 Adb(Android Debug Bridge)是Androids调试的桥梁工具。一、Android设备连接 作为一个新手常常喜欢使用USB线的方式连接来调试,但是很多时候采用USB数据线调试不是特别方便,Androids可以采用无线的方式来调试。1.通过有线的方式先把Android设备的开发者模式打开Android设备需要开启 USB 调试。把Android设备通过USB数据线连接到电脑原创 2021-09-08 14:17:37 · 795 阅读 · 0 评论 -
Android开发系列5——BroadcastReceiver详解
前言BroadcastReceiver(广播接收器)是Android四大组价之一,是一种广泛运用的在应用之间消息传输机制。顾名思义,是一个接收广播(broadcast intent)的一个类。所以想理解好BroadcastReceiver工作原理,必须带着一些问题去看:1.广播的机制是什么?2.广播是怎么发送出来的?3.广播内容是什么,怎么传递给接收器?4.BroadcastRecei...原创 2020-03-18 22:01:24 · 864 阅读 · 0 评论 -
Android开发系列4——Service详解
前言 Service是Android的四大组件之一,在Android开发过程中是一个必不可少的组件。 Service是一种可在后台执行长时间运行操作而不提供界面的应用组件。Service可以由Activity、Context等多种组件启动,而且还可以通过其他应用组件启动,而且即使用户切换到其他应用,Activity页面切换,Service一直都会保持在后台运行服务。此外,组件可以通过绑定到...原创 2020-03-17 22:17:55 · 355 阅读 · 0 评论 -
Android开发系列11——Handler消息处理机制
前言 Android的消息处理机制其实就是另外一种形式的”事件处理“,这种机制主要是为了解决Android应用的多线程问题。理解Handler的消息机制,首先要从几个方面了解Handler消息处理机制。Handler是什么?(Handler的概念)Handler可以做什么?(Handler的用途)Handler怎么使用?(Handler的用法)其次,需要了解Handler消息处理...原创 2020-03-16 16:44:59 · 764 阅读 · 0 评论 -
Android开发系列10——事件处理机制
前言 &emspp;Android开发采用Java语言,同时拥有多种Android的组件的包配合开发。Android本质是一种静态语言的开发模式。 手机用户通过Android设备屏幕的各种动作进行交互,交互过程是:Android系统对动作做出响应机制就是事件处理。Android提供了两种事件处理机制基于事件监听的事件处理基于回调的事件处理一、基于监听的事件处理二、基于...原创 2020-03-12 09:24:28 · 582 阅读 · 0 评论 -
Android开发系列9——UI开发详解
前言Android的UI开发采用两种方式:1.编写XML;2.纯代码编写IOS的UI开发两种方式:1.storyboard、XIB2.纯代码编写布局管理器有以下:布局类型布局名称详细介绍LInearLayout线性布局TableLayout表格布局(继承LInearLayout)FrameLayout帧布局(继承ViewGroup...原创 2020-03-10 14:01:51 · 1273 阅读 · 0 评论 -
Android开发系列8——纯代码+XML混编UI界面
前言 Android应用的UI组件大多数都在Android.widget包及其子包、Android.view包及其子包中。Android应用的所有UI组件都继承View类,View组件类似IOS中的UIView,代表一个白色的显示UI区域。 View类还要一个重要的子类:ViewGroup(容器类)。 Android所有的UI组件底层都是继承于View,一些组件继承于ViewGroup...原创 2020-03-09 15:39:16 · 1196 阅读 · 0 评论 -
Android开发系列6——项目中res详解
https://blog.youkuaiyun.com/delmoremiao/article/details/66550290原创 2020-03-05 12:39:21 · 3193 阅读 · 0 评论 -
Android开发系列7——icon图标和开机启动页
一、Android应用图标Android的应用图标icon 配置在AndroidManifest.xml文件中,<?xml version="1.0" encoding="utf-8"?><manifest xmlns:android="http://schemas.android.com/apk/res/android" package="com.ftimage....原创 2020-03-04 17:41:36 · 3302 阅读 · 0 评论 -
Android开发系列3——Intent详解
前言 Intent:从字面上的意思是:意图;目的;含义;目标。但在Android的开发过程中却扮演了一个非常重要的角色。一、Intent详解1.Intent概念理解 1)Intent是一个消息传递对象,可以通过多种方式促进组件之间的通信,也可以用于从其他应用组件操作。 2)Intent对象携带Android系统用来确定要启动那些组件的信息(例如:准确的组件名称或应当接收该Inten...原创 2020-03-02 14:53:55 · 545 阅读 · 0 评论 -
Android开发系列2——Activity页面跳转详解
Android开发中,Activity页面之间的跳转可以分为两大类型。其中两种中又有不同的方法和方式,接下来会详细介绍页面跳转的每种方式。Intent是一个消息传递对象,可以用于其他应用请求操作。Intent可以通过多种方式促进组件之间的通信,接下来只讲解Intent启用Activity,页面跳转的部分。Intent由以下各个组成部分:component(组件):目的组件action(...原创 2020-02-27 13:35:54 · 2471 阅读 · 2 评论 -
Android开发系列1——Activity详解
Activity类是Android应用开发的一个关键组件(相当于IOS中的UIViewController类),简单的明了的说就是一个页面。一、Activity生命周期 首先,一个Activity在其生命周期中需要经历几个状态,每个状态是什么含义,每个状态都做了那些,每个状态需要做什么等。只有了解Activity生命周期,才能更好地开发Android程序。 Android开发者平台官...原创 2020-02-26 15:09:46 · 484 阅读 · 0 评论 -
Android开发系列0——Android开发环境的配置Mac
工欲善其事,必先利其器。学习一种编程语言也是一样,必须把开发环境配置好,才能非常迅速的学习。 Mac电脑上配置Android的开发环境,其实非常简单的一件事。 网络上常用配置方法: 作为一个初学者,你可能在网上看到太多分享关于Mac电脑配置Android开发环境的分享,很多文章都是千篇一律的。第一步:下载Java的JDK包,安装第二步:下载Android SDK安装第三步:下...原创 2020-02-24 18:04:20 · 334 阅读 · 0 评论 -
Android开发系列——Hardcoded Text
在Android开发过程中,在UI布局过程中,设置Button、TextView中默认的文字出现警告: Warning:Hardcoded string “XXXXX”, should use @string resource 。可以通过字面意思大概知道问题的根源在于直接设置text(硬编码问题)。 接下来了解一下什么是硬编码:硬编码: 是将数据直接嵌入到程序或其他可执行对象的源代...原创 2020-02-23 08:41:09 · 8032 阅读 · 0 评论 -
Android 开发遇到的坑
学习Android开发,配置开发环境遇到的一些细节问题原创 2017-08-22 17:34:43 · 561 阅读 · 0 评论